    New trend in stat padding?

    Ever since BF2 expanded their rank to include officers, i noticed stat padding has increased. Specially, clans are stat padding to get "expert" badges or achieve general rank.

    Has anyone noticed this?

    Since rev 1.2 i have been playing Sharqi alot. This also seems to be the map of choice for people trying to earn their expert badges.

    Clan members will sit in the AA Platform game after game at the far MEC base (where the APC is located and people rarely ever travel to). I asked a few of the people doing this what they were doing and they said they were working on their expert AA badge.

    The other day i was playing on a smaller sharqi map and 9 of the players were on the same clan. they were on different teams but working together to earn their expert explosives badge.

    What makes me mad about this is the later example, both friendly and enemy clan members were shooting at my chopper. They were also shielding each other so when i attacked the enemy soldier (their clan member) i also hit a friendly (also a clan member) and thus i eventually got booted for excess team kills. It mad me mad cause the entire MEC team was on their clan, thus one of the few 24x7 sharqi servers was void of game play.

                            Re: New trend in stat padding?

                            I think ea almost encourage stat padding, especially with the high ranks requiring expert badges and some of the expert requirements being so far removed from the possibilities of 'normal' gameplay.
                            It does of course depend on your definition of stat padding, sitting in the jeep in the water for repair is, dropping thousands of claymores isnt- it seems. Yet in both situations you are playing solely for the benifit of your stats- to pad them out.
                            EA tempt fate by setting certain badges beyond what is realisticly achievable in the game without a player deliberately playing for the stats. It would be less of a problem if they did away with the crazy IAR points requirements for knife, repair etc and made them a global requirement- eg total of 1000 knife kills or 3000 repairs. That way they still arent easy to get, require more dedication to get them and encourage players to use various kits/equiptment generally rather than half our knife fests we see to day. It also serves to help eliminate stat padders as it makes it such a long term project that it would potentially take days rather than minutes for padders to see any new award appear.
                            But its deffinately true that you will see people now sitting in aa scoring 0 points/round just because they need the time stat, even tanks etc. It is an odd thing to do but it would take you forever to naturally get the aa time required or TOW time in otherwise.
                            EA created the stat padders are arent humble enough to have a five minute think about the problem.
